What is a Toddler Bunk Bed?
A toddler bunk bed is a dual-level sleeping structure created specifically for young kids, usually aged between 2 and 5 years of ages. The upper bunk is typically raised with a safety rail, while the lower bunk can be either a basic bed mattress or a trundle bed for additional sleeping space.

Safety should be the primary issue when selecting a toddler bunk bed. Here are some essential guidelines to make sure a safe sleeping environment:
Height: Ensure that the height of the upper bunk is appropriate for your child's age and capability.Protective Rails: Always select beds with guardrails on the upper bunk to prevent falls.Durable Construction: Look for beds made from strong wood or top quality metal with enough weight capability.Age Restrictions: Some producers specify age limitations for the upper bunk; adhere strictly to these guidelines.Bed Placement: Keep the bed far from windows, lights, or any other possible dangers.Upkeep of Toddler Bunk Beds

What age is suitable for a toddler bunk bed?
Most specialists recommend that kids start using a bunk bed once they are at least 6 years of ages. However, some toddler-specific designs may be ideal for kids as young as 2 or 3.

5. What is the weight limitation for toddler bunk beds?
Weight limitations differ by design. Typically, manufacturers suggest weight limits ranging in between 150 to 200 pounds for upper bunks. Always refer to the bed's requirements.
